data recovery ✔✔Retrieving files that were deleted accidentally or purposefully.
When an unexpected event occurs, your main objective is to __________________________ as
soon as possible, while minimizing the disruption to your business functions. ✔✔resume normal
operations
A _____________________________ is a way for you to document any problems you discovered
along the way, and most importantly, the ways you fixed them so you can make sure they don't
happen again. ✔✔post-mortem
The standard medium for archival backup data storage is
______________________________________. These use spools of magnetic tape, a cheap
storage option usually used for long-term archival purposes, where delays in getting the data isn't
a concern. ✔✔data tapes
rsync ✔✔Remote file and directory synchronization;
commonly used as a backup utility because it supports compression and you can use SSH to
securely transfer data over a network
Mac OS uses a backup utility is called ___________________________. It operates the using an
incremental backup model. ✔✔Time Machine
Microsoft uses _____________________________ which includes two modes of operation: 1)
file-based backups - complete or incremental - to a zip archive and 2) the system image where the
entire disk is saved block by block to a file, only backing up blocks that have changed since the
last backup. ✔✔Backup and Restore
Disaster Recovery Testing ✔✔Annual scenarios that can be anything from a simulated natural
disaster, like an earthquake to a fictional event like a horde of zombies shutting down an office.
Differential backup ✔✔A backup that contains copies of the files that have changed since the last
full system backup.
While a differential backup backs up files that have been changed or created since the last full
backup, an ________________________________ is when only the data that's changed in files
since the last incremental backup is backed up. ✔✔incremental backup
___________________________________________________ is a method of taking multiple
physical disks and combining them into one large virtual disk. ✔✔Redundant Array of
Independent Disks (RAID)
Storing data on a _______________________ doesn't protect against accidentally deleting files,
or malware corrupting your data. ✔✔RAID array
RAID is not a replacement for _______________________. ✔✔backups
A ____________________________________ is a collection of documented procedures and
plans on how to react and handle an emergency or disaster scenario, from the operational
perspective, including things that should be done before,
during and after a disaster. ✔✔disaster recovery plan
___________________ measures cover any procedures or systems in place that will proactively
minimize the impact of a disaster. ✔✔Preventative
_________________ measures are meant to alert you and your team that a disaster has occurred
that can impact operations. ✔✔Detection
Environment Concerns For Disaster Events ✔✔1) Flood Sensors
2) Temperature and Humidity Sensors
3) Smoke Detectors and Fire Alarms
4) Evacuation of Employees (temp work locations if necessary)
Corrective or _______________ measures are those enacted after a disaster has occurred,
including steps like restoring lost data from backups or rebuilding and reconfiguring systems that
were damaged. ✔✔recovery
When one system in a redundant pair suffers a failure,
it's called a ___________________ of failure because it only takes one more failure to completely
take the system down. ✔✔single point
A ______________________ allows you to prioritize certain aspects of
an organization that is more at risk during an unforeseen event. It can involve brainstorming and
analyzing the impact of damaging events. ✔✔risk assessment
We create a _________________________ after an incident, an outage,
or some event when something goes wrong, or at the end of a project to analyze how it went,
including things that went well and things that didn't. ✔✔post-mortem
What sections are includded in writing a post-mortem? ✔✔1) Brief Summary - w/dates, times,
timezones
- What the incident was
- How long it was
- What the impact was
- How it was fixed
2) Detailed Timeline - w/dates, times, timezones
3) Root Cause - What can be learned?
4) Resolution and Recovery Efforts
- more detail about what steps were taken to recover, the rationale and the reasoning behind those
actions, and the outcome of each step
5) Actions to Avoid the Same Scenario
